Hi there yeas you are crrect after fiddling around i have managed to overclock it ( udsing fsb) to 230 fsb meaning its gone from 2.9 ghz to 3.2 ghz which is only a small oc i know but if i put it to 235 or 240 fsb it fails to boot the pc up unless i drop my ram down to 400 mhz :s ( ihave 800mhz apparently but for some reason default is 400mhz ?? ) as for the multiplier it is higher on the stock of 2.9ghz x 14.5.... i can change this down to 2.8 x 14 2.7 x 13.5 and so on to around x 7 i believe but i cannot change it higher than 14.5 so if you could help me resolve it around getting higher than 230mhz i would be much appreciated any info you need i will happilyu resoplve

maybe you can push up the volts on the fsb some, ( a small bit at a time ) and maybe drop down the multiplier .5 points at a time from stock... ( my mobo multiplier only gos up to x16 ) i hate that but i will be over clocking the fsb too... i am only looking to get it to 3.5 on 3.7...

3.2 is not to bad of a over clock.... keek a eye on cpu temp..... :ouch:
